Job Description

The Director of CMC Industry and Regulatory Intelligence is responsible for enabling chemistry, manufacturing and controls (CMC) quality and compliance excellence by ensuring Regeneron IOPS maintains effective systems for monitoring, analyzing, communicating, implementing, and influencing global regulatory and industry trends, regulations, and pharmacopoeia. In this role, you will be encouraged to develop and implement strategies to translate CMC intelligence gathering into action and influence policy and standards for all CMC operations across Regeneron.A typical day might include, but is not limited to, the following:Providing oversight on the IOPS CMC intelligence programCollaborating with the Regulatory Intelligence and GMP Compliance & Inspections teams to support and drive activities that ensure appropriate regulatory intelligence and compliance information is maintained and made available throughout IOPSMonitoring and assessing all sources of global CMC intelligence information for relevance and impact to internal processes, drug development projects and/or regulatory strategies and ensuring that internal procedures are introduced or adapted to respond to changes in the regulatory environmentDeveloping internal guidance, position papers, training materials and communications to ensure leadership and staff are informed on regulatory compliance information, risks and trends, and how existing procedures might need to be amended to remain in complianceDeveloping and implementing strategies to ensure that our products and processes are compliant with relevant regulations, collaborating with internal and external stakeholders, and providing guidance to teams across the organizationEstablishing working groups, facilitating discussions, and leading presentations that examine regulatory intelligence and analysis of emerging trends and risks by bringing together subject matter experts from across all departments and levels to ensure complianceEngaging industry trade/professional associations in leadership positions to represent Regeneron and influence the external regulatory environment.Contributing to conference presentations, journal publications, and actively participating in appropriate professional bodies and regulatory forumsThis Role May Be For You IfYou possess strong communication skills, both oral and writtenYou have strong negotiation skills to reach consensusYou demonstrate strong project management leadership skillsYou understand the drug development and commercialization process, with a focus on CMCYou have the ability to research, analyze and extrapolate critical regulatory informationYou are team-oriented and a positive relationship builderYou are able to optimally collaborate with a range of individuals across the organization at all levelsTo be considered for this opportunity you must hold a Bachelor's degree in Life Science, preferably related to health, environment or politics or related degree. Associate Director requires 15+ years of related experience in a regulated industry or health authority. Director requires 18+ years of related experience in a regulated industry or health authority.
